Interface RolloutUpdateEventOrBuilder (1.39.0)

public interface RolloutUpdateEventOrBuilder extends MessageOrBuilder

Implements

MessageOrBuilder

Methods

getMessage()

public abstract String getMessage()

Debug message for when a rollout update event occurs.

string message = 6;

Returns
TypeDescription
String

The message.

getMessageBytes()

public abstract ByteString getMessageBytes()

Debug message for when a rollout update event occurs.

string message = 6;

Returns
TypeDescription
ByteString

The bytes for message.

getPipelineUid()

public abstract String getPipelineUid()

Unique identifier of the pipeline.

string pipeline_uid = 1;

Returns
TypeDescription
String

The pipelineUid.

getPipelineUidBytes()

public abstract ByteString getPipelineUidBytes()

Unique identifier of the pipeline.

string pipeline_uid = 1;

Returns
TypeDescription
ByteString

The bytes for pipelineUid.

getRelease()

public abstract String getRelease()

The name of the Release.

string release = 8;

Returns
TypeDescription
String

The release.

getReleaseBytes()

public abstract ByteString getReleaseBytes()

The name of the Release.

string release = 8;

Returns
TypeDescription
ByteString

The bytes for release.

getReleaseUid()

public abstract String getReleaseUid()

Unique identifier of the release.

string release_uid = 2;

Returns
TypeDescription
String

The releaseUid.

getReleaseUidBytes()

public abstract ByteString getReleaseUidBytes()

Unique identifier of the release.

string release_uid = 2;

Returns
TypeDescription
ByteString

The bytes for releaseUid.

getRollout()

public abstract String getRollout()

The name of the rollout. rollout_uid is not in this log message because we write some of these log messages at rollout creation time, before we've generated the uid.

string rollout = 3;

Returns
TypeDescription
String

The rollout.

getRolloutBytes()

public abstract ByteString getRolloutBytes()

The name of the rollout. rollout_uid is not in this log message because we write some of these log messages at rollout creation time, before we've generated the uid.

string rollout = 3;

Returns
TypeDescription
ByteString

The bytes for rollout.

getRolloutUpdateType()

public abstract RolloutUpdateEvent.RolloutUpdateType getRolloutUpdateType()

The type of the rollout update.

.google.cloud.deploy.v1.RolloutUpdateEvent.RolloutUpdateType rollout_update_type = 5;

Returns
TypeDescription
RolloutUpdateEvent.RolloutUpdateType

The rolloutUpdateType.

getRolloutUpdateTypeValue()

public abstract int getRolloutUpdateTypeValue()

The type of the rollout update.

.google.cloud.deploy.v1.RolloutUpdateEvent.RolloutUpdateType rollout_update_type = 5;

Returns
TypeDescription
int

The enum numeric value on the wire for rolloutUpdateType.

getTargetId()

public abstract String getTargetId()

ID of the target.

string target_id = 4;

Returns
TypeDescription
String

The targetId.

getTargetIdBytes()

public abstract ByteString getTargetIdBytes()

ID of the target.

string target_id = 4;

Returns
TypeDescription
ByteString

The bytes for targetId.

getType()

public abstract Type getType()

Type of this notification, e.g. for a rollout update event.

.google.cloud.deploy.v1.Type type = 7;

Returns
TypeDescription
Type

The type.

getTypeValue()

public abstract int getTypeValue()

Type of this notification, e.g. for a rollout update event.

.google.cloud.deploy.v1.Type type = 7;

Returns
TypeDescription
int

The enum numeric value on the wire for type.